From: Karsten Loesing Date: Sun, 15 Aug 2010 12:30:37 +0000 (+0200) Subject: Run test_stats in a subprocess. X-Git-Tag: tor-0.2.2.15-alpha~23^2 X-Git-Url: http://git.ipfire.org/gitweb.cgi?a=commitdiff_plain;h=0e8513d4c6f54ec56b4009502adf16bdde2108fd;p=thirdparty%2Ftor.git Run test_stats in a subprocess. --- diff --git a/src/test/test.c b/src/test/test.c index ff166cef25..9a98a1a0a7 100644 --- a/src/test/test.c +++ b/src/test/test.c @@ -1233,6 +1233,8 @@ const struct testcase_setup_t legacy_setup = { test_ ## group ## _ ## name } #define DISABLED(name) \ { #name, legacy_test_helper, TT_SKIP, &legacy_setup, name } +#define FORK(name) \ + { #name, legacy_test_helper, TT_FORK, &legacy_setup, test_ ## name } static struct testcase_t test_array[] = { ENT(buffers), @@ -1241,7 +1243,7 @@ static struct testcase_t test_array[] = { ENT(policies), ENT(rend_fns), ENT(geoip), - ENT(stats), + FORK(stats), DISABLED(bench_aes), DISABLED(bench_dmap),